Question:   A field is in the shape of a trapezium whose parallel sides are 25 m and 10 m. The non-parallel sides are 14 m and 13 m. Find the area of the field.




Answer:   
Let us draw BE || AD

Then ABED is a parallelogram BE = 13 m DE = 10 m EC = 15 m

For BEC,












Height of trapezium = 11.2 m

Area of field

= 196 m2
